Mattel have dropped the Hot Ones line (replaced with the Flying Customs, which is a throwback to the late 70s HW line instead of the early/mid 80s), the last run of the series was supposedly short so these BRAT's are likely to remain pretty HTF as they vanish into collections.

 

No news yet on whether the casting will pop up in the mainline this year (the green is from the Boulevard series, which is a bit more premium (rubber wheels)).
